Hutchmoot

Hutchmoot is a weekend of music and conversation about the stories all around us in song, film, books--and most importantly how our stories intersect each other's with the Great Story.

Fika & Stilla
Open Hours and Quiet Hours at North Wind Manor

We throw open the doors of North Wind Manor to the community twice every week, once for a loud and family-friendly time of gathering (Fika) and another for a quieter atmosphere of reading and study (Stilla). Come and say hello!

Local Show

On the first Tuesdays of most months, the Rabbit Room presents the Local Show at North Wind Manor


Each show features a new line-up of some of Nashville's best singers and songwriters. The show is one way in which we incarnate the Rabbit Room community, cultivate local singer-songwriters, and nourish our local communities with music, laughter, and hope.
